Transaction 253dc27aa9005d03aabdcadab916b405b88a8490c07835d8d00e7e185be5f729
1 Input
1 Output
-
253dc27aa9005d03aabdcadab916b405b88a8490c07835d8d00e7e185be5f729:0
- value
- 12133163
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e574765120abc551371dd6de2c52556a34a636da OP_EQUAL
- address
- 3NcGBQYVGCVfttJffpkGUkJFAPhKrZakSP